Anyways, here is the step-by-step illustration. All products MAC unless otherwise noted.

Apply
Urban Decay primer potion all over lid and browbone. Smooth with finger. Using a fluffy shader brush, apply
Perky paint pot all over lid.

Using the
242 brush, pack
Bare Escentuals Citrus Twist glimmer shadow dry on the lid using quick patting motions.

Using the
224 brush, apply
Sunplosion shadow on the crease.

Using
Sonia Kashuk blending brush, apply the brown side of the
Inter-View mineralize eyeshadow trio on the crease and outer V, blending into
Sunplosion. Add more
Sunplosion to blend into
Inter-View, and add more
Citrus Twist if necessary.

Using the
227 brush, apply
NARS All About Eve eyeshadow duo (I used the satin/non-shimmer side) to highlight and on inner corners (I love this duo! Review coming up).


Line using
Blacktrack fluidline. Tightline and waterline using UD 24/7 liner in
Zero. Apply
Ardell 109 falsies, apply mascara.
